The battle scene sculptures of the Soldiers’ & Sailors’ Monument are monumental but it’s the thousands of carved names inside that bring home the real agony of Civil War . It's free to visit.
Look for the two African-American figures among the sculptures : Outside, a sailor from the integrated U.S. Navy of the 1860s loads a cannon. Inside, a former slave rises as Lincoln liberates him.
